The Role
The post holder will be responsible and accountable for the delivery of an accessible, appropriate, high quality and effective nursing service to all age groups in the community by working in partnership with patients, care providers and other agencies.
The post holder will ensure a person-centered approach to care delivery that is safe and effective, maintaining quality standards.
The post holder will function as an independent autonomous practitioner with in-depth knowledge, expertise, and experience to lead and enable the Community nursing team to provide quality nursing services.
The post holder will lead, manage, and support the Community nursing team, be a clinical expert, involved in public health activities, accountable for a caseload over 24 hours, and be a key member of the Integrated Primary Care team and other multidisciplinary groups.

What you'll need
* Registered Nurse with valid NMC Registration
* SPQ District Nursing/Nursing in the Home or equivalent Post Graduate Study
* Educated to/working towards/operating at Degree Level
* Postgraduate expertise in your specialty demonstrating leadership and knowledge
* Knowledge of clinical guidelines and standards
* Experience with relevant conditions, pathology, policies, and procedures
* Leadership skills for managing service delivery
* Continuous Professional Development including postgraduate qualifications
* Teamwork, motivation, initiative, and excellent communication skills
* Basic IT skills
Please note: a full UK/EU/EEA driving license is required for roles needing driving.
